HON.  CHIBUZO OGAMBA COMMENDS COMPT. EDELDOUK FOR HER VIGILANCE AT KLT COMMAND

By Mcanthony Onuoha

 

The MD/CEO of Sigaba Logistics Nigeria Limited, Hon. Chibuzo Valentine Ogamba, has commended the Customs Area Controller of Kirikiri Lighter Terminal (KLT) Command, Compt. Joy Edeldouk and her team for their recent landmark achievement in the fight against illicit drugs trafficking.

 

In line with the Comptroller General of Custom’s policy thrust of Collaboration, Innovation and Consolidation, the vigilant officers of KLT Command of Nigeria Customs Service, in conjunction with the National Drug Law Enforcement Agency(NDLEA), intercepted 140 parcels of Cannabis Sativa, smuggled into Nigeria from Canada, weighing 51.25 kg, and valued at N256,250,000.00 as Street Price.

Compt. Edeldouk disclosed this to Journalists during the handing over of the drugs to National Drug Law Enforcement Agency(NDLEA) for thorough investigation and prosecution alongside the three suspects arrested in connection with the seizure.

 

In a statement personally signed and made available to The Prestige Magazine Online and print, Hon Chibuzo Ogamba, a staunch member of Association of Nigerian Licensed Customs Agents- ANLCA, passed a vote of confidence on the CAC, describing the seizure as a landmark achievement in the war against illegal importation and suppression of unwholesome drugs .

 

The statement read in part, ” l wish to commend the Customs Area Controller of Kirikiri Lighter Terminal Command, Compt. Joy Edeldouk and her team of vigilant officers for the massive seizure of unwholesome drugs carried out recently at the Command. The Comptroller by that singular feat, has sent a strong message to peddlers of illicit drugs who think that KLT Command is starkly porous for smugglers”.

 

” The Controller has raised a red flag for those who are bent on circumventing laid down trade rules and putting the lives of our young people in danger. And what these people seem not to know is that even their own children can be destroyed by the drugs they illegally import into this Country”.

 

” I hereby passionately urge those who indulge in this obnoxious act of unwholesome drugs importation to desist for the sake of their children and future generations.
I wish to pass a vote of confidence on the CAC, l strongly believe that if given maximum support, she will do better than her predecessors. And l want to urge freight forwarders to give her the needed support to achieve more of this feat at KLT Command.”

 

Addressing Journalists at the event, Compt. Edeldouk said that 140 parcels of Cannabis Sativa smuggled into Nigeria, violated the provision of the Nigeria Customs Service(NCS) Act 2023, Section 55, Subsection 1c and 1f”.

 

“The interception is a testament to the continued dedication and commitment to safeguarding Nigerian Boarders from the importation of illicit and harmful substances,” the statement read.

 

Finally in his statement, Hon. Chibuzo Ogamba expressed optimism that Compt. Joy Edeldouk and her team would revive the Command and make it business friendly for importers and freight forwarders.
